121 * Color conversion values have 3 separate fixed point formats:
123 * 10 bit fields (ay, au)
124 * 1.9 fixed point (b.bbbbbbbbb)
125 * 11 bit fields (ry, by, ru, gu, gv)
126 * exp.mantissa (ee.mmmmmmmmm)
127 * ee = 00 = 10^-1 (0.mmmmmmmmm)
128 * ee = 01 = 10^-2 (0.0mmmmmmmmm)
129 * ee = 10 = 10^-3 (0.00mmmmmmmmm)
130 * ee = 11 = 10^-4 (0.000mmmmmmmmm)
131 * 12 bit fields (gy, rv, bu)
132 * exp.mantissa (eee.mmmmmmmmm)
133 * eee = 000 = 10^-1 (0.mmmmmmmmm)
134 * eee = 001 = 10^-2 (0.0mmmmmmmmm)
135 * eee = 010 = 10^-3 (0.00mmmmmmmmm)
136 * eee = 011 = 10^-4 (0.000mmmmmmmmm)
137 * eee = 100 = reserved
138 * eee = 101 = reserved
139 * eee = 110 = reserved
140 * eee = 111 = 10^0 (m.mmmmmmmm) (only usable for 1.0 representation)
142 * Saturation and contrast are 8 bits, with their own representation:
143 * 8 bit field (saturation, contrast)
144 * exp.mantissa (ee.mmmmmm)
145 * ee = 00 = 10^-1 (0.mmmmmm)
146 * ee = 01 = 10^0 (m.mmmmm)
147 * ee = 10 = 10^1 (mm.mmmm)
148 * ee = 11 = 10^2 (mmm.mmm)

1259 * The pipe scanline counter behaviour looks as follows when
1260 * using the TV encoder:
1269 * dsl=0 ___/ |_____/ |
1272 * | | | | pipe vblank/first part of tv vblank
1273 * | | | bottom margin
1276 * remainder of tv vblank
1278 * When the TV encoder is used the pipe wants to run faster
1279 * than expected rate. During the active portion the TV
1280 * encoder stalls the pipe every few lines to keep it in
1281 * check. When the TV encoder reaches the bottom margin the
1282 * pipe simply stops. Once we reach the TV vblank the pipe is
1283 * no longer stalled and it runs at the max rate (apparently
1284 * oversample clock on gen3, cdclk on gen4). Once the pipe
1285 * reaches the pipe vtotal the pipe stops for the remainder
1286 * of the TV vblank/top margin. The pipe starts up again when
1287 * the TV encoder exits the top margin.
1289 * To avoid huge hassles for vblank timestamping we scale
1290 * the pipe timings as if the pipe always runs at the average
1291 * rate it maintains during the active period. This also
1292 * gives us a reasonable guesstimate as to the pixel rate.
1293 * Due to the variation in the actual pipe speed the scanline
1294 * counter will give us slightly erroneous results during the
1295 * TV vblank/margins. But since vtotal was selected such that
1296 * it matches the average rate of the pipe during the active
1297 * portion the error shouldn't cause any serious grief to
1298 * vblank timestamps.
1300 * For posterity here is the empirically derived formula
1301 * that gives us the maximum length of the pipe vblank
1302 * we can use without causing display corruption. Following
1303 * this would allow us to have a ticking scanline counter
1304 * everywhere except during the bottom margin (there the
1305 * pipe always stops). Ie. this would eliminate the second
1306 * flat portion of the above graph. However this would also
1307 * complicate vblank timestamping as the pipe vtotal would
1308 * no longer match the average rate the pipe runs at during
1309 * the active portion. Hence following this formula seems
1310 * more trouble that it's worth.
1312 * if (IS_GEN(dev_priv, 4)) {
1313 * num = cdclk * (tv_mode->oversample >> !tv_mode->progressive);
1314 * den = tv_mode->clock;
1316 * num = tv_mode->oversample >> !tv_mode->progressive;
1319 * max_pipe_vblank_len ~=
1320 * (num * tv_htotal * (tv_vblank_len + top_margin)) /
1321 * (den * pipe_htotal);

1932 * The documentation, for the older chipsets at least, recommend
1933 * using a polling method rather than hotplug detection for TVs.
1934 * This is because in order to perform the hotplug detection, the PLLs
1935 * for the TV must be kept alive increasing power drain and starving
1936 * bandwidth from other encoders. Notably for instance, it causes
1937 * pipe underruns on Crestline when this encoder is supposedly idle.
1939 * More recent chipsets favour HDMI rather than integrated S-Video.
